*Mumbai: *Pritam is known to be a workaholic and the last year he ended up with 13 releases, his highest so far. The music director already has 11 films lined up for release this year and the number is only going to increase in the coming months. <http://www.dnaindia.com/img/1341556.jpg> <http://www.dnaindia.com/img/1341556.jpg> Pritam Chakraborty talks about why awards elude him despite being a successful music director. The workaholic that Pritam is, he took his first tiny break in the last one-and-a-half years, when he went off to Goa recently. “The main reason why I end up doing so many projects is that I am unable to say ‘no’ to anyone. I don’t think I’m that stressed though. Many music directors do that much work. I think Shankar-Ehsaan-Loy do around nine projects every year. In fact, Himesh used to do much more work than me,” he says. Despite doing so many film tracks, awards have always eluded Pritam so far. “I won the Producers Guild Awards recently but I never win an award when the jury is involved. I really don’t know why,” he says. On most occasions he has lost out to AR Rahman despite multiple nominations, each year since 2006. “I am okay with Rahman winning the award because he’s very good. I remember there was one year when I had three nominations and yet I didn’t win,” he says, adding, “you know, RD Burnman didn’t win an award till *Love Story*, which was much later in his career. Jatin-Lalit haven’t won the big award either despite some great music.
